France have lost two more players before the start of the Six Nations with Camille Chat and Raphaël Lakafia reportedly ruled out.
Racing 92 hooker Chat and Stade Français number eight Lakafia have both been ruled out before the start of the tournament, according to Sky Sports.
Lakafia will not be replaced while Chat’s place will be taken by Christopher Tolofua.
The news comes in the wake of an injury spree in the French camp with star player Wesley Fofana as well as Eddy Ben Arous, François Trinh-Duc and Henry Chavancy all being ruled out due to injury.
France’s first game of the Six Nations is against England at Twickenham on February 4.
